The next few weeks will be essential to see if Cruz Azul manages to get into the top positions, although for that, it will have a very difficult first obstacle. Next Saturday, September 2, the Machine will face the Eagles of America.
The squad led by Joaquín Moreno arrives in 16th position in the general table with just 4 points added. This after three defeats, a draw and a victory in their last five matches. However, they managed to beat Rayados as visitors, so they arrive with the illusion to the fullest.
Those led by André Jardine are in position 5, momentarily, with 8 units. They depend on the game between Pachuca and Atlético San Luis to know their place in this day. They come from a bitter draw against León at home and have a couple of draws, two wins and only one game lost in the last five games.
